About the role
Join a specialist defence technology firm where the work is genuinely high impact, building secure communications and data systems that operate in complex, real‑world environments.
Opportunities to get hands-on with advanced tech (AI, cyber, comms) and see it deployed in live, mission-critical settings rather than just theory.
Important: Candidates must be able to obtain and maintain BPSS security clearance and as a minimum be living in the UK for at least 5 years.
Working: 9-day fortnight with every other Friday off
Join the team in Hertfordshire, a specialist engineering site focused on deployable, high-performance communications tech the kind used when standard networks go down or don't exist. It's very hands-on, with teams designing and delivering systems that are used in real-world operations globally.
Overview
As a Prototype Wire Person, you will work as part of a small, collaborative team to produce high-quality communication equipment, ensuring all work meets required standards and delivery timescales.
Main responsibilities:
- Carry out electro-mechanical assembly
- Build sub-assemblies and complete systems in line with engineering drawings and build procedures
- Monitor product quality throughout the build process, contributing to continuous improvement against production targets
- Panel wiring
- Cable assembly and crimping
- Rack wiring
- PCB assembly
- Assembly and rework of components
- Wiring of test boxes
- Soldering, including through-hole and surface-mount components
- Ensure the security of information in line with organisational information security policies
Experience needed:
- Proven experience in electrical/mechanical assembly and wiring, including prototype wiring
- High attention to detail, with a commitment to maintaining quality standards and the ability to work independently
- Ability to read and interpret electrical and mechanical drawings, following procedures accurately
- A proactive mindset, with a willingness to learn and develop
- Eligibility to obtain and maintain the required security clearance (BPSS)
